Understanding the Laparotomy Hysterectomy Procedure

A laparotomy hysterectomy involves the surgical removal of a woman's uterus through a large abdominal incision. This procedure is typically recommended when less invasive approaches are not suitable, particularly in cases involving large fibroids, pelvic malignancies, or extensive endometriosis. The term 'laparotomy' refers to the open surgical technique that allows the surgeon direct access to the pelvic organs for precise and safe removal of the uterus.

Why Choose a Laparotomy Hysterectomy?

  • Complex Cases: When medical conditions or anatomy require extensive access that minimally invasive techniques can't provide.
  • Larger Uterus: Particularly effective when the uterus is enlarged due to fibroids or other pathology.
  • Malignancies: Often preferred in the surgical management of uterine or pelvic cancers for comprehensive removal.
  • Previous Surgeries: Cases with extensive adhesions from prior surgeries may necessitate open surgery for safety.

The Step-by-Step Process of a Laparotomy Hysterectomy

Preoperative Preparation

Prior to surgery, patients undergo thorough assessments including blood tests, imaging studies like ultrasound or MRI, and consultations with their healthcare team to evaluate overall health, discuss risks, and obtain informed consent. Patients are advised to follow fasting guidelines and arrange transportation post-surgery due to anesthesia.

Surgical Procedure Overview

The laparotomy hysterectomy generally proceeds as follows:

  1. Anesthetic Administration: The patient is put under general anesthesia to ensure comfort and immobility during the operation.
  2. Incision: A large incision, typically horizontal (bikini line) or vertical, is made in the lower abdomen based on the surgeon’s assessment.
  3. Accessing Pelvic Cavity: The surgeon carefully separates tissues and muscles to reach the pelvic organs, taking care to minimize trauma.
  4. Identification of Structures: The uterus, fallopian tubes, and ovaries are clearly identified.
  5. Uterus Removal: The uterus is detached from surrounding tissues, including the ligaments, blood vessels, and supporting structures.
  6. Hemostasis and Closure: Bleeding points are controlled, and the incision is closed in layers with sutures or staples for optimal healing.

Postoperative Care and Recovery

After the surgery, patients are transferred to a recovery room for close monitoring. Postoperative care involves pain management, preventing infections, and promoting healing. Generally, hospitalization lasts 2-4 days depending on individual cases and recovery progress.

Recovery Timeline

  • Immediate Recovery (First week): Limited mobility, careful wound management, and gradual resumption of fluids and light activities.
  • Within 2-4 Weeks: Patients typically can return to light activities; however, strenuous exercise and heavy lifting are discouraged.
  • Long-term Recovery (6 weeks or more): Full healing and return to normal routines, with periodic follow-ups to monitor healing.

Potential Risks and Complications

As with any surgical procedure, a laparotomy hysterectomy carries some risks, including infection, bleeding, damage to surrounding organs (bladder, bowel), anesthesia reactions, and blood clots. Choosing an experienced surgical team minimizes these risks and ensures optimal outcomes.

Innovations and Future Directions in Hysterectomy Surgery

While the laparotomy hysterectomy remains a gold standard for certain cases, ongoing advancements in medical technology are transforming women's health surgery. Minimally invasive techniques such as laparoscopic and robot-assisted hysterectomies are increasingly preferred for their reduced pain and faster recovery. Nonetheless, the open abdominal approach (laparotomy) persists due to its unmatched utility in complex or large cases. The future of hysterectomy surgery emphasizes personalized approaches, combining technological innovations with surgical expertise.
